Solution for 4x+87=8x-5 equation:


Simplifying
4x + 87 = 8x + -5

Reorder the terms:
87 + 4x = 8x + -5

Reorder the terms:
87 + 4x = -5 + 8x

Solving
87 + 4x = -5 + 8x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-8x' to each side of the equation.
87 + 4x + -8x = -5 + 8x + -8x

Combine like terms: 4x + -8x = -4x
87 + -4x = -5 + 8x + -8x

Combine like terms: 8x + -8x = 0
87 + -4x = -5 + 0
87 + -4x = -5

Add '-87' to each side of the equation.
87 + -87 + -4x = -5 + -87

Combine like terms: 87 + -87 = 0
0 + -4x = -5 + -87
-4x = -5 + -87

Combine like terms: -5 + -87 = -92
-4x = -92

Divide each side by '-4'.
x = 23

Simplifying
x = 23
